I can't delete ANY multimedia file. I get an error message saying that the file is being used by another process.
I seem to remember this is something to do with the Windows XP preview pane in Explorer... and there's a registry hack of some kind to get rid of it, enabling you to delete the file.
Can ANYONE please help? This is driving me nuts!

Remove the following
registry key.
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E/SOFTWARE/Classes/CLSID/{87D62D94-71B3-4b9a-9489-5FE6850DC73E}/InProcServer32
This will prevent Explorer from loading shmedia.dll in response to file property queries on these files.
If you do a "search" for this key it will not be found, look for it manually it is very easy to find.
